Person Specification

Knowledge

Essential

Up to date Clinical knowledge of clinical and professional practice in upper limb orthopaedics and hand therapy and in splinting and cast bracing

Desirable

Awareness of local, regional and national healthcare priorities.

Qualifications

Essential

Graduate Diploma or Degree in Occupational Therapy or Physiotherapy State Registration

Further Training

Essential

Attendance at postgraduate courses relevant to upper limb orthopaedics and hand therapy Clinical educator training

Desirable

Leadership training

Experience

Essential

Experience on a junior rotation Rotation in MSk hands and upper limb

Desirable

Experience of clinical supervision of occupational therapy students
